To improve quality score, I will focus on optimizing keywords, ad relevance, landing page experience, and CTR.
Optimize keywords to match search intent
Improve ad relevance by aligning ad copy with keywords
Enhance landing page experience to increase user engagement
Increase CTR by testing different ad creatives and CTAs

Logistic regression is a linear model used for binary classification, while SVM is a non-linear model that can handle complex decision boundaries.
Logistic regression is a probabilistic model that predicts the probability of a binary outcome based on input features.
SVM aims to find the hyperplane that best separates the classes in a high-dimensional space.
Logistic regression is more interpretable and easier to implement...
